Default Continue pushing?

Villain has been 46/14.3/0.9 over 168 hands. To my surprise I don't have any notes on his PFR range despite that 14.3. As an example of his style I saw him cold-call with A9o and then call a bet on a flop of K22.

Yes, push, I think you played the hand optimally. This villain is passive so you can't be sure you are ahead because with a three flush they may have played AQ this way but there are many more hands that they play this way that you do beat. This player is most likely a complete fish and you make money in this game by value betting hands like this.
